The Circle of Friends You Should Have

Edna Buchanan said it best when she said, “Friends are the family we choose for ourselves.” We all have an individual(s) that we call a friend. That friend may embody one or all of these characteristics OR you can surround yourself with several who do.  Either way, if you have one that has one of these characteristics, still consider yourself very lucky!

a.  A person who lifts you up. You know the kind who always says yes, encouraging you to do what you want to do.  She’s your cheerleader.

b.  A person who enjoys going with you on adventures trips. This person is always raring to give an outing a try. She would be the one that you call for a late night cocktail or coffee, with no questions asked.

c.  A truth teller is the one that you go to for frank and honest conversations. She shares her perspective out of love and respect and not envy or malice.

d.  The party girl is your friend who is mostly about spontaneous good times. You  may not share your heart and soul but you will try out the new club in the area.

e. The other friend is the one you would never think you would be close with. You know, she’s older, out of your usual social group or economic status, yet she adds a richness to your life you don’t get from others.

Lucky are we who have people in our lives, whether it be one or five,  who we can truly call a FRIEND.
